A Career of Unapologetic Mayhem
Born Sidney Charles Eudy on July 19, 1960, Sid Vicious made his professional wrestling debut in 1985, quickly establishing himself as a force to be reckoned with in the world of sports entertainment. With his towering 6-foot-9-inch frame and imposing physique, Sid Vicious was the embodiment of chaos and destruction, leaving a trail of devastation in his wake with his signature moves, including the devastating powerslam and the infamous “Sid Drop.”
Throughout his illustrious career, Sid Vicious clashed with some of the biggest names in professional wrestling, including Hulk Hogan, Bret Hart, and Shawn Michaels, in a series of epic battles that will be remembered for generations to come. Despite his on-screen persona as a ruthless and cunning heel, Sid Vicious was widely respected by his peers for his unwavering dedication to the sport and his unshakeable work ethic.

A Posthumous Honour Fit for a Legend
Sid Vicious passed away on August 26, 2024, at the age of 63, after a long battle with cancer. The news of his passing sent shockwaves throughout the professional wrestling community, with fans and fellow wrestlers alike paying tribute to a man who left an indelible mark on the world of sports entertainment.
